Is The Dolce Gusto Infinissima Automatic?

The machine will stop by itself automatically How does the system work? The nescafé dolce gusto machine heats water, which is passed at high pressure – a maximum of 15 bars – through a capsule of high quality roast and ground or soluble products (milk, chocolate, etc.) depending on the capsule variety. What Is Instantaneous Coffee?

instant coffee, also called soluble coffee, coffee crystals, coffee powder, or powdered coffee, is a beverage derived from brewed coffee beans that enables people to quickly prepare hot coffee by adding hot water or milk to the powder or crystals and stirring What does instant coffee mean? Is Coffee Powder The Same As Instant Coffee?

But instant coffee is a cup of coffee that’s already been brewed and has been processed and preserved in packaging. ground coffee is not processed beyond the usual steps of washing and roasting before being packaged and shipped to a coffee shop where it begins its natural deterioration process.
